Sempra has cancelled its proposed Vista Pacifico liquefied natural gas (LNG) project in Topolobampo, Sinaloa, marking a significant victory for environmentalists and local communities. This cancellation is the second of three major LNG projects planned for the Gulf of California, a region renowned for its biodiversity and dubbed the “aquarium of the world.” The decision follows intense opposition from Mexican communities and U.S. supporters, including the NRDC, who raised concerns about the project’s impact on climate, marine life, and local fisheries.
